A few ideas that I'd suggest, in order to improve our school's technology, would include:
1. Hosting some type of benefit/fundraiser at the school that would raise money & create a jump start for new technology. If people noticed that the event was going toward a good cause, they might be more likely to give.
2. Another method that could be used is to maybe start off with only a few really good computers that we're able to afford, then per semester , increase the number, 1 or 2 at a time.
3. And a third idea that was suggested by another student, was to maybe get together with the insiders associated with the Sister Beata Ball. With the help from their organization, I believe we just might be successful in receiving something to improve our way of learning. I say this because the organization usually does a great job with the annual auctions. For instance, one year they were able to raise enough money at an auction to buy equipment for the science department here at Benedictine University.
